Verschil Tussen SuperSPARC En UltraSPARC

Verschil Tussen SuperSPARC En UltraSPARC
Verschil Tussen SuperSPARC En UltraSPARC

Video: Verschil Tussen SuperSPARC En UltraSPARC

Video: Verschil Tussen SuperSPARC En UltraSPARC
Video: UltraSPARC T1 2024, Mei
Anonim

SuperSPARC versus UltraSPARC

SPARC (afgeleid van Scalable Processor ARChitecture) is een RISC (Reduced Instruction Set Computing) ISA (Instruction Set Architecture) ontwikkeld door Sun Microsystems. Deze SPARC-microprocessors zijn te vinden in notebooks tot supercomputers zoals bedrijfsservers. Ze draaien besturingssystemen zoals Solaris, OpenBSD en NetBSD. SuperSPARC is de versie van SPARC die is ontwikkeld in 1992. SuperSPARC-microprocessor gebruikt de SPARC V8-architectuurversie. UltraSPARC is de SPARC-microprocessor, die SuperSPARC heeft vervangen. UltraSPARC is in 1995 ontwikkeld door Sun Microsystems. UltraSPARC gebruikte de V9 SPARC ISA en het was de eerste SPARC-microprocessor die de V9 ISA gebruikte.

SuperSPARC

SuperSPARC is de versie van de SPARC-microprocessor die in 1992 werd uitgebracht door Sun Microsystems. Het had de codenaam Viking. SuperSPARC-microprocessor gebruikt de SPARC V8 ISA. Sun introduceerde SuperSPARC-microprocessorversies van 33 MHz en 40 MHz. In SuperSPARC zaten 3,1 miljoen transistors. Texas Instruments (TI) heeft deze microprocessor in Japan vervaardigd. SuperSPARC + en SuperSPARC-II waren twee afgeleiden van SuperSPARC. De bedoeling achter het uitbrengen van SuperSPARC + microprocessor was om enkele bugs in de originele versie op te lossen. De SuperSPARC-II-microprocessor, die in 1994 werd uitgebracht, was echter een verbeterde versie vergeleken met de originele SuperSAPRC-microprocessor met snelheden tot 80-90 MHz. SuperSAPRC-microprocessor had een L1-cache van 16 KB. De L2-cache had een capaciteit van 2 MB. L3-cache was niet aanwezig in SuperSPARC-microprocessor. SuperSPARC-II had de codenaam Voyager.

UltraSPARC

UltraSPARC is de versie van de SPARC-microprocessor die in 1995 door Sun Microsystems is uitgebracht en die SuperSPARC-II vervangt. Het gebruikte V9 ISA van SPARC-architectuur. In feite was het de eerste SPARC-microprocessor op basis van 64 bit SPARC V9 ISA. Texas Instruments heeft de fabricage van 64 bit UltraSPARC uitgevoerd. 32 64-bits vermeldingen waren in het integer-registerbestand. Het is een superscalaire processor, die instructies in volgorde uitvoert in een pijplijn met negen fasen. Er waren twee ALU-eenheden, maar er kon er maar één vermenigvuldigen en delen. UltraSPARC-microprocessor heeft een speciaal type drijvende-komma-eenheid genaamd FGU (floating-point / grafische eenheid), die ook multimedia-ondersteuning biedt. Er zijn twee cacheniveaus: primair en secundair. De primaire cache is 16 KB en de secundaire cache is 512 KB tot 4 MB. Het had zes invoer- en uitvoerpoorten in de vorm van drie lees- en drie schrijfbewerkingen. Het bevatte 3,8 miljoen transistors.

Wat is het verschil tussen SuperSPARC en UltraSPARC?

SuperSPARC en UltraSPARC microprocessors hebben veel verschillen, vooral sinds UltraSPARC microprocessor SuperSPARC in 1995 verving. SuperSPARC microprocessor gebruikte V8 SPARC ISA, terwijl UltraSPARC microprocessor de eerste SPARC microprocessor was die V9 SPARC ISA gebruikte. In feite was de UltraSPARC-microprocessor een 64-bits microprocessor. Het is begrijpelijk dat de UltraSPARC-microprocessor hogere klokfrequenties had dan de SuperSPARC-microprocessor. In termen van functionele eenheden was er een merkbaar verschil. Om hogere klokfrequenties te bereiken dan SuperSPARC, heeft de UltraSPARC-microprocessor eenvoudigere eenheden. Dit werd bijvoorbeeld bereikt door de ALU-eenheden niet in cascade te plaatsen om ervoor te zorgen dat de klokfrequentie niet werd beperkt. SuperSPARC-microprocessor had 3.1 transistors, terwijl UltraSPARC 3.8 transistors had. UltraSPARC-microprocessor had een grotere L2-cache in vergelijking met SuperSPARC's L2. Over het algemeen leverde UlatraSPARC betere prestaties op alle gebieden in vergelijking met SuperSPARC.

Aanbevolen: